The one being shown here is better than all of them, actually. Ssl hijacking an ssl man inthe middle attack works like this. Intro to wireshark and man in the middle attacks commonlounge. Dec 26, 2019 packet capturenetwork traffic sniffer app with ssl decryption.
Wireshark is capturing all packets to the man inthemiddless ip but wont pass it through to the end device. Fiddler issues its own certificate and acts a man in the middle. Packet capturenetwork traffic sniffer app with ssl decryption. How to install wireshark in termux without root android. Man inthemiddle attacks come in two forms, one that involves physical proximity to the intended target, and another that involves malicious software, or malware. Hi, where can i download wireshark version with ssl decryption support gnutls and gcrypt for ubuntu or win32. You will see a flurry of arp traffic to both hosts and immediately begin seeing the communication between them. These two purposes are independent, so several attacks can be launched simultaneously. What is a maninthemiddle attack and how can you prevent it. I think you are accepting a ssl certificate for the proxy server, and not for the end website you are visiting.
The middle mouse button can be used to mark a packet. It features sniffing of live connections, content filtering on the fly and many other interesting tricks. But your home lan doesnt have any interesting or exotic packets on it. Mar 03, 2016 now its 120x more likely youll get unlived by a family member. Please note that this is not a general purpose proxy server performance issues and lack of capabilities. The server key has been stolen means the attacker can appear to be the server, and there is no way for the client to know. No ads simple to use web debugger no root required. But for this task you need active man in the middle. In a man in the middle mitm attack, an attacker inserts himself between two network nodes. How to decrypt ssl traffic using wireshark haxf4rall. It decrypts ssl by acting as a mitm proxy, no need to setup a proxy server on your computer. Apart from wireshark, i tried using mitmproxy and mitmdump but in vain. The man in the middle attack works by tricking arp or just abusing arp into updating its mappings and adding our attacker machines mac address as the corresponding mac address for any communication task we wish to be in the middle of.
I have indeed the private key of the proxy that is doing man in the middle for the users, i do not have an issue with the users browsers trusting that certificate that the proxy is generating. Updated instructions and printscreens for wireshark v3. Now you can use tools like tcpdump or wireshark to capture the cleartext traffic to a file or watch it in real time. In this article we are going to examine ssl spoofing, which is inherently one of the most potent mitm attacks because it allows for exploitation of services that people assume to be secure. Once a hacker has performed a man in the middle attack mitm on a local network, he is able to perform a number of other sidekick attacks. With wireshark your not doing an active mitm nor swapping certificates.
Steve gibsons fingerprint service detects ssl man in the middle spying we have all heard over and over again that secure web pages are safe. Norton security protects you from mitm attacks such as ssl strip attacks, content tampering or content manipulation attacks, and dns spoofing attacks. Talking about an android application that has those certificates. Ssl is one the best ways to encrypt network traffic and avoiding man in the middle attacks and other session hijacking attacks. Now we are going to initiate a man in the middle mitm attack while using wireshark to sniff for tls ssl exchanges and browser cookies that could be. All present and past releases can be found in our download area installation notes. But there are still multiple ways by which hackers can decrypt ssl traffic and one of them is with the help of wireshark. A list of publicly available pcap files network traces that can be downloaded for. Now its 120x more likely youll get unlived by a family member. Mitmproxy an sslcapable maninthemiddle proxy hacker news.
Man inthe middle attacks on ssl are really only possible if one of ssl s preconditions is broken, here are some examples. Packet capture for android free download and software. This blog explores some of the tactics you can use to keep your organization safe. So today i will be showing you how you can now install wireshark in termux for android users without root permission i. Not that feature rich as wireshark yet, but its a powerful debugging tool especially when developing an app. Youve probably run into a problem a lot of it is encrypted. Your iot device probably talks to a server, to which it relays back analytics and instructions it has received from its user. Ive tested some man inthe middle apps traffic packet capture in android, and in some apps works very well, but in others it disables internet capabilities in the app and the app stop to work and. So youre at home tonight, having just installed wireshark. Executing a maninthemiddle attack in just 15 minutes. The key flag for running in text mode is t, with the q flag helping to keep things quiet. This allows us to understand, and potentially modify, how it works.
Man in the middle mitm ssl proxies simple ways to see traffic between an ssl server and client in clear text. When you receive an alert from norton security that a man inthe middle attack is detected, select the recommended action from the alert window. Its one of the simplest but also most essential steps to conquering a network. Youd be sure to capture the ssl handshakes and cert exchanges. It is used most commonly in web browsers, but can be used with any protocol that uses tcp as the transport layer. A man inthe middle attack mitm is an attack against a communication protocol where the attacker relays and modifies messages in transit. Getting in the middle of a connection aka mitm is trivially easy. Debug proxy is a network traffic monitor that helps you to debug your network applications ie check if your rest api is working correctly, latency check etc. Past releases can be found by browsing the allversions directories under each platform directory. Obviously, you know that a man in the middle attack. Download packet capture latest 1 5 0 android apk apkpure com packet capture android latest 1 5 0 apk download and install capture packets without root decrypts ssl using man in the middle technique aburizal s blog laporan aplikasi wireshark sumber.
Steve gibsons fingerprint service detects ssl man in the. Maninthemiddle attacks mitm are much easier to pull off than most people. Wireshark is also capable of reading any of these file formats if they are compressed using gzip. We do not need to start a man in the middle mitm proxy. It supports active and passive dissection of many protocols even ciphered ones and includes many. How would i setup a man in the middle scenario with windows xp. The parties believe they are talking to each other directly, but in fact both are talking to each other via the attacker in the middle. What is a man in the middle cyberattack and how can you prevent an mitm attack in your own business. Recent versions of wireshark can use these log files to decrypt packets. Man in the middle attack in your case, since you control the network and the client, configuring the client to go through something like burpsuite and accept burpsuites ca certificate as trusted on your client would be a good place to start. Harvesting passwords with man in the middle, arp poisoning, and dns spoofing duration. Want to be notified of new releases in byt3bl33d3rmitmf. The ssltls master keys can be logged by mitmproxy so that external programs can decrypt ssltls connections both from and to the proxy. Analysis of a maninthemiddle experiment with wireshark.
Download windows installer download linux binaries. I need to implement the ssl decrypter on a machine that acts as a sniffer. Just set the environment variable sslkeylogfile to a file where you want to store the keys. This second form, like our fake bank example above, is also called a man inthebrowser attack. How to maninthemiddle proxy your iot devices robert heaton. Theres an api server that only allows connections including specific ssl certificates. Joe testa as implement a recent ssh mitm tool that is available as open source.
My issue resides in the fact that i cannot decrypt ssl traffic using wireshark or other tools. Firefox, chrome and curl offer the possibility to save the sessionkeys for s connections. How would i setup a man inthe middle scenario with windows xp. There is no need to tell wireshark what type of file you are reading. Obviously, you know that a maninthemiddle attack occurs when a. Then, on another computer, youd have to verify the certs yourself insure that you. This video from defcon 20 about the subterfuge man inthe middle attack framework. It is a free and open source tool that can launch man inthe middle attacks. It seems i can only capture off one interface at a time. One of the things the ssl tls industry fails worst at is explaining the viability of, and threat posed by man inthe middle mitm attacks. Now that you are familiar with some attacks, i want to introduce a popular tool with the name ettercap to you. Where can i download wireshark version with ssl decryption. Sep 25, 2018 ssl hijacking an ssl maninthemiddle attack works like this.
Now we are going to initiate a man in the middle mitm attack while using wireshark to sniff for tls ssl exchanges and browser cookies that could be used to hijack a browser session. This is also a good indepth explanation of how the attack works and what can. Man in the middle attack using ettercap, and wireshark. Newest wireshark questions information security stack. The textual interface is actually a cursesbased interface that lets you do stuff as you would normally do in paros, such as capture a request or edit a request and replay it. Jul 14, 2017 ssl is one the best ways to encrypt network traffic and avoiding man in the middle attacks and other session hijacking attacks. Feb 06, 2012 i have used stanfords ssl mitm, paros and webscarab. Man in the middle mitm ssl proxies simple ways to see. As wireshark progresses, expect more and more protocol fields to be allowed in display filters. Ettercap is a suite for man in the middle attacks on lan. If you want to get my cybersecurity certification bundle from cosmicskills. Nov 21, 2019 when man in the middle ing a device, we intercept and inspect the online traffic that goes in and out of it.
I used a man inthe middle openwrt box, running tcpdump, to capture an entire tr069 session in which a firmware update was sent from my isp to the modemrouter and installed. The following man pages are part of the wireshark distribution. Hello, i have a device in a network doing ssl sniffing man in the middle i have the private key that it uses this key is manually trusted by the hosts. What is a man inthe middle cyberattack and how can you prevent an mitm attack in your own business. When i instal the private key into wireshark, and open a capture i do not see any clear text packets.
So far we have discussed arp cache poisoning, dns spoofing, and session hijacking on our tour of common man in the middle attacks. When you receive an alert from norton security that a maninthemiddle attack is detected, select the recommended action from the alert window. Now that we understand what were gonna be doing, lets go ahead and do it. I know this because i have seen it firsthand and possibly even contributed to the problem at points i do write other things besides just hashed out. This page will explain points to think about when capturing packets from ethernet networks if you are only trying to capture network traffic between the machine running wireshark or tshark and other machines on the network, you should be able to do this by capturing on the network interface through which the packets will be transmitted and received. One of the things the ssl tls industry fails worst at is explaining the viability of, and threat posed by man in the middle mitm attacks. My locked, isp branded modemrouter runs a tr069 daemon that periodically checks for firmware updates. Browse other questions tagged tls man in the middle wireshark or ask your own question.
They are available via the man command on unix posix systems and html files via the start menu on windows systems. I actually developed it for my needs about examining connections of mobile. Analysis of a man inthe middle experiment with wireshark minghsing chiu, kuopao yang, randall meyer, and tristan kidder department of computer science and industrial technology southeastern louisiana university, hammond, louisiana abstract with the rapid growth of the internet user. Debookee is a network traffic analyzer, ssl tls decryption tool for mobiles iphone, ipad, android and wifi monitoring tool for macos which allows you to monitor the traffic of all your devices and mobiles. Knowing that it is impossible for me to get the private key from my decoder, i am looking for a way to use a proxy basically man in the middle that will enable me to generate a new certificate so i can use its private key on wireshark instead of the one of my decoder to. Inspect ssltls traffic from chromefirefoxcurl with. The preferences dialog will open, and on the left, youll see a list of items. An interceptor for socks proxy protocol to allow user to dump any connections content even if it is secured with ssl. Once your browser is logging premaster keys, its time to configure wireshark to use those logs to decrypt ssl. Implementation of the capturing option is similar to mitm man inthe middle proxies like squid.
Analysis of a man in the middle experiment with wireshark minghsing chiu, kuopao yang, randall meyer, and tristan kidder department of computer science and industrial technology southeastern louisiana university, hammond, louisiana abstract with the rapid growth of the internet user. Disecting a captured firmware update session tr069 and. A man in the middle attack using ettercap and wireshark to sniff transmitted requests. Packet capturing is performed with the pcap library. For a complete list of system requirements and supported platforms, please consult the users guide information about each release can be found in the release notes each windows package comes with the latest stable release of npcap, which is required for live packet capture. If you are curious to see what is happening behind the scenes try installing wireshark and listen to the interface when you enable poisoning. Some remarks on the preventive measures were made based on the result. Executing a maninthemiddle attack in just 15 minutes hashed out. You dont need to setup a dedicated proxy server on your pc. In a man inthe middle mitm attack, an attacker inserts himself between two network nodes. Date index thread index other months all mailing lists. Wireshark is capturing all packets to the man in the middless ip but wont pass it through to the end device.
1413 809 486 1375 1171 1031 861 45 1354 1478 1109 218 1120 1444 20 1180 312 614 1021 299 228 90 102 475 1208 823 952 1243 1289 1274 754 1476 415 1047